Offering a Rich Learning Environment
Community School is an independent elementary and preschool serving families with children age 3 through sixth grade. Students excel in an environment that balances intellectual challenge and nurturing support. The 7:1 student/teacher ratio allows for personalized attention and active, experiential learning. Visual and performing arts, foreign language, and physical education programs complement the academic curriculum, creating a rich learning experience. As a testament to their preparation, Community students’ test scores are among the highest in the nation.
Community School’s beautiful 18-acre campus–with its woods, trails, pond, fields, and treehouse–provides a safe setting for exploration and a deeper understanding of concepts learned in the classroom. The school’s emphasis on character development, service learning, and public speaking helps prepare students to be tomorrow’s leaders. For more than 100 years, Community has served as a joyous place for children as they fall in love with learning.
Quick Looks:
- Grades: Age 3—Grade 6
- Student/Teacher Ratio: 7:1
- Enrollment: 345
- Tuition: $15,300—$22,555
